Wilfred Ndidi emerges as the best tackler in Premier League for 2019
Wilfred Ndidi has once again proven that his prowess in the midfield is no fluke as he becomes the best tackler in the lucrative English Premier League. According to statistics conducted by Opta for 2019, the Nigerian international was heads and shoulders above every defensive midfielder with 161 tackles all through the year.
The 23-year-old has been a key member of Brendan Rodgers’ Leicester City side that are riding high in the English topflight division this season.
Ndidi has featured in every Premier League game for the Foxes this season except one, as they sit in second position behind leaders Liverpool. Crystal Palace’s Wilfred Zaha was regarded as the player with the best take-ons and the most fouls won with 166 and 117 respectively.
